*,:before,:after,::backdrop{--un-rotate:0;--un-rotate-x:0;--un-rotate-y:0;--un-rotate-z:0;--un-scale-x:1;--un-scale-y:1;--un-scale-z:1;--un-skew-x:0;--un-skew-y:0;--un-translate-x:0;--un-translate-y:0;--un-translate-z:0;--un-pan-x: ;--un-pan-y: ;--un-pinch-zoom: ;--un-scroll-snap-strictness:proximity;--un-ordinal: ;--un-slashed-zero: ;--un-numeric-figure: ;--un-numeric-spacing: ;--un-numeric-fraction: ;--un-border-spacing-x:0;--un-border-spacing-y:0;--un-ring-offset-shadow:0 0 #0000;--un-ring-shadow:0 0 #0000;--un-shadow-inset: ;--un-shadow:0 0 #0000;--un-ring-inset: ;--un-ring-offset-width:0px;--un-ring-offset-color:#fff;--un-ring-width:0px;--un-ring-color:#93c5fd80;--un-blur: ;--un-brightness: ;--un-contrast: ;--un-drop-shadow: ;--un-grayscale: ;--un-hue-rotate: ;--un-invert: ;--un-saturate: ;--un-sepia: ;--un-backdrop-blur: ;--un-backdrop-brightness: ;--un-backdrop-contrast: ;--un-backdrop-grayscale: ;--un-backdrop-hue-rotate: ;--un-backdrop-invert: ;--un-backdrop-opacity: ;--un-backdrop-saturate: ;--un-backdrop-sepia: }.visible{visibility:visible}.absolute,[position~=absolute]{position:absolute}.fixed,[position~=fixed]{position:fixed}.relative,[position~=relative]{position:relative}.sticky,[position~=sticky]{position:sticky}.inset-0,[inset~="0"],[position~=inset-0]{inset:0}.bottom-0,[position~=bottom-0]{bottom:0}.bottom-4,[position~=bottom-4]{bottom:1rem}.right-0,[position~=right-0]{right:0}.right-4,[position~=right-4]{right:1rem}.top-0,[position~=top-0]{top:0}[left~="8"]{left:2rem}[z~="40"]{z-index:40}[z~="45"]{z-index:45}[z~="50"]{z-index:50}.grid,[grid=""]{display:grid}.m-5,.m5{margin:1.25rem}.m10{margin:2.5rem}.m10\.065{margin:2.51625rem}.m10\.5{margin:2.625rem}.m10\.6{margin:2.65rem}.m10\.8{margin:2.7rem}.m11{margin:2.75rem}.m12{margin:3rem}.m12\.4{margin:3.1rem}.m12\.829{margin:3.20725rem}.m12\.83{margin:3.2075rem}.m13{margin:3.25rem}.m13\.1{margin:3.275rem}.m13\.4{margin:3.35rem}.m13\.41{margin:3.3525rem}.m13\.5{margin:3.375rem}.m13\.56{margin:3.39rem}.m13\.6{margin:3.4rem}.m14{margin:3.5rem}.m14\.3{margin:3.575rem}.m14\.5{margin:3.625rem}.m14\.622{margin:3.6555rem}.m14\.7{margin:3.675rem}.m15{margin:3.75rem}.m15\.2{margin:3.8rem}.m15\.477{margin:3.86925rem}.m15\.5{margin:3.875rem}.m15\.7{margin:3.925rem}.m16{margin:4rem}.m16\.01{margin:4.0025rem}.m16\.5{margin:4.125rem}.m16\.6{margin:4.15rem}.m16\.8{margin:4.2rem}.m16\.9{margin:4.225rem}.m17{margin:4.25rem}.m17\.66{margin:4.415rem}.m18{margin:4.5rem}.m19{margin:4.75rem}.m19\.07{margin:4.7675rem}.m19\.1{margin:4.775rem}.m19\.5{margin:4.875rem}.m19\.6{margin:4.9rem}.m2,[m~="2"]{margin:.5rem}.m20{margin:5rem}.m20\.66{margin:5.165rem}.m20\.7{margin:5.175rem}.m21{margin:5.25rem}.m21\.5{margin:5.375rem}.m21\.7{margin:5.425rem}.m21\.73{margin:5.4325rem}.m21\.854{margin:5.4635rem}.m22{margin:5.5rem}.m3{margin:.75rem}.m3\.2{margin:.8rem}.m3\.34{margin:.835rem}.m4,[m~="4"]{margin:1rem}.m4\.03{margin:1.0075rem}.m4\.74{margin:1.185rem}.m4\.9{margin:1.225rem}.m4\.93{margin:1.2325rem}.m6{margin:1.5rem}.m6\.158{margin:1.5395rem}.m6\.2{margin:1.55rem}.m6\.34{margin:1.585rem}.m6\.5{margin:1.625rem}.m7{margin:1.75rem}.m7\.5{margin:1.875rem}.m7\.9{margin:1.975rem}.m8{margin:2rem}.m8\.3{margin:2.075rem}.m8\.5{margin:2.125rem}.m9{margin:2.25rem}.m9\.2{margin:2.3rem}.m9\.4{margin:2.35rem}.m9\.5{margin:2.375rem}.m9\.7{margin:2.425rem}[m~="0"]{margin:0}[m~="1"]{margin:.25rem}[mx~=auto]{margin-left:auto;margin-right:auto}[m~=b-0]{margin-bottom:0}[m~=b-4]{margin-bottom:1rem}[m~=b-6]{margin-bottom:1.5rem}[m~=t-10]{margin-top:2.5rem}[m~=t-16]{margin-top:4rem}[m~=t-2]{margin-top:.5rem}[m~=t-3]{margin-top:.75rem}[m~=t-6]{margin-top:1.5rem}.block,[block=""]{display:block}.inline-block{display:inline-block}.list-item{display:list-item}.hidden{display:none}[aspect~="1/1"]{aspect-ratio:1}[aspect~="4/3"]{aspect-ratio:4/3}[size~="10"]{width:2.5rem;height:2.5rem}[size~="11"]{width:2.75rem;height:2.75rem}[size~="18"]{width:4.5rem;height:4.5rem}[size~="20"]{width:5rem;height:5rem}[size~="58px"]{width:58px;height:58px}[h~="31"]{height:7.75rem}[h~=full]{height:100%}[max-w~="5xl"]{max-width:64rem}[max-w~="60"]{max-width:15rem}[max-w~="64"]{max-width:16rem}[max-w~="6xl"]{max-width:72rem}[max-w~="92"]{max-width:23rem}[min-h~="44"]{min-height:11rem}[min-h~="72px"]{min-height:72px}[w~="28"]{width:7rem}[w~=full]{width:100%}.flex,[flex~=\~]{display:flex}.shrink{flex-shrink:1}[flex~=col]{flex-direction:column}.transform{transform:translateX(var(--un-translate-x)) translateY(var(--un-translate-y)) translateZ(var(--un-translate-z)) rotate(var(--un-rotate)) rotateX(var(--un-rotate-x)) rotateY(var(--un-rotate-y)) rotateZ(var(--un-rotate-z)) skewX(var(--un-skew-x)) skewY(var(--un-skew-y)) scaleX(var(--un-scale-x)) scaleY(var(--un-scale-y)) scaleZ(var(--un-scale-z))}[cursor~=pointer]{cursor:pointer}.items-start,[flex~=items-start]{align-items:flex-start}.items-end,[flex~=items-end]{align-items:flex-end}.items-center,[flex~=items-center]{align-items:center}.justify-end,[flex~=justify-end]{justify-content:flex-end}.justify-center,[flex~=justify-center]{justify-content:center}.justify-between,[flex~=justify-between]{justify-content:space-between}[gap~="1"]{gap:.25rem}[gap~="1.35"]{gap:.3375rem}[gap~="1.5"]{gap:.375rem}[gap~="14"]{gap:3.5rem}[gap~="2"]{gap:.5rem}[gap~="2.25"]{gap:.5625rem}[gap~="3"]{gap:.75rem}[gap~="4"]{gap:1rem}[gap~="8"]{gap:2rem}.overflow-hidden,[overflow~=hidden]{overflow:hidden}.b,.border,[border=""]{border-width:1px}.b-0,[border~="0"]{border-width:0}.b-4{border-width:4px}.b-5{border-width:5px}.b-6{border-width:6px}[border~=b]{border-bottom-width:1px}[border~=l]{border-left-width:1px}[border~=t]{border-top-width:1px}[border-color~="[hsl(var(--border))]"]{--un-border-opacity:1;border-color:hsl(var(--border) / var(--un-border-opacity))}[border-color~="[rgb(156_122_77_/_0.34)]"]{--un-border-opacity:.34;border-color:rgb(156 122 77/var(--un-border-opacity))}[border-color~="[rgb(229_224_215_/_0.16)]"]{--un-border-opacity:.16;border-color:rgb(229 224 215/var(--un-border-opacity))}[rounded~=full]{border-radius:9999px}[rounded~=lg]{border-radius:var(--radius)}[rounded~=xl]{border-radius:.75rem}.bg-red-500{--un-bg-opacity:1;background-color:rgb(239 68 68/var(--un-bg-opacity)) }[bg~="[color-mix(in_srgb,var(--brand-background)_92%,white)]"]{background-color:color-mix(in srgb,var(--brand-background) 92%,white) }[bg~="[color-mix(in_srgb,var(--brand-card)_72%,transparent)]"]{background-color:color-mix(in srgb,var(--brand-card) 72%,transparent) }[bg~="[color-mix(in_srgb,var(--brand-ink)_8%,transparent)]"]{background-color:color-mix(in srgb,var(--brand-ink) 8%,transparent) }[bg~="[rgb(47_58_61_/_0.34)]"]{--un-bg-opacity:.34;background-color:rgb(47 58 61/var(--un-bg-opacity)) }[bg~="[var(--brand-background)]"]{background-color:var(--brand-background) }[bg~="[var(--brand-card)]"]{background-color:var(--brand-card) }[bg~="[var(--brand-ink)]"]{background-color:var(--brand-ink) }[bg~=transparent]{background-color:#0000}[bg~="hover:[var(--brand-ink)]"]:hover{background-color:var(--brand-ink) }[stroke-width~="1"]{stroke-width:1px}[stroke-width~="2"]{stroke-width:2px}[stroke~=none]{stroke:none}[object~=cover]{object-fit:cover}[object~=contain]{object-fit:contain}[p~="0"]{padding:0}[p~="1"]{padding:.25rem}[p~="4"]{padding:1rem}[p~="5"]{padding:1.25rem}[p~=x-4]{padding-left:1rem;padding-right:1rem}[p~=y-10]{padding-top:2.5rem;padding-bottom:2.5rem}[p~=y-2]{padding-top:.5rem;padding-bottom:.5rem}[p~=y-3]{padding-top:.75rem;padding-bottom:.75rem}[p~=y-8]{padding-top:2rem;padding-bottom:2rem}[p~=b-5]{padding-bottom:1.25rem}[p~=b-6]{padding-bottom:1.5rem}[p~=l-5]{padding-left:1.25rem}[p~=r-14]{padding-right:3.5rem}[p~=r-5]{padding-right:1.25rem}[p~=t-22]{padding-top:5.5rem}[p~=t-4]{padding-top:1rem}[p~=t-6]{padding-top:1.5rem}.text-align-center,[text~=center]{text-align:center}[text~="2xl"]{font-size:1.5rem;line-height:2rem}[text~="3xl"]{font-size:1.875rem;line-height:2.25rem}[text~=sm]{font-size:.875rem;line-height:1.25rem}[text~=xl]{font-size:1.25rem;line-height:1.75rem}[text~=xs]{font-size:.75rem;line-height:1rem}[text~="[rgb(229_224_215_/_0.68)]"]{--un-text-opacity:.68;color:rgb(229 224 215/var(--un-text-opacity)) }[text~="[rgb(229_224_215_/_0.78)]"]{--un-text-opacity:.78;color:rgb(229 224 215/var(--un-text-opacity)) }[text~="[var(--brand-accent)]"]{color:var(--brand-accent) }[text~="[var(--brand-background)]"]{color:var(--brand-background) }[text~="[var(--brand-ink)]"]{color:var(--brand-ink) }[text~="hover:[var(--brand-accent)]"]:hover{color:var(--brand-accent) }[text~="hover:[var(--brand-background)]"]:hover{color:var(--brand-background) }[font~="600"]{font-weight:600}[font~="700"]{font-weight:700}[leading~="6"]{line-height:1.5rem}[leading~="7"]{line-height:1.75rem}[leading~=none]{line-height:1}[leading~=tight]{line-height:1.25}[decoration~=none]{text-decoration:none}[shadow~="[-24px_0_48px_rgb(47_58_61_/_0.18)]"]{--un-shadow:-24px 0 48px var(--un-shadow-color,#2f3a3d2e);box-shadow:var(--un-ring-offset-shadow), var(--un-ring-shadow), var(--un-shadow)}.filter{filter:var(--un-blur) var(--un-brightness) var(--un-contrast) var(--un-drop-shadow) var(--un-grayscale) var(--un-hue-rotate) var(--un-invert) var(--un-saturate) var(--un-sepia)}.transition{transition-property:color,background-color,border-color,text-decoration-color,fill,stroke,opacity,box-shadow,transform,filter,-webkit-backdrop-filter,backdrop-filter;transition-duration:.15s;transition-timing-function:cubic-bezier(.4,0,.2,1)}.ease,.ease-in-out{transition-timing-function:cubic-bezier(.4,0,.2,1)}.ease-in{transition-timing-function:cubic-bezier(.4,0,1,1)}.ease-out{transition-timing-function:cubic-bezier(0,0,.2,1)}@media (width>=768px){.md\:grid-cols-\[1\.25fr_0\.75fr_0\.75fr\]{grid-template-columns:1.25fr .75fr .75fr}.md\:hidden{display:none}.md\:size-\[64px\]{width:64px;height:64px}[flex~=md\:row]{flex-direction:row}.md\:items-start,[flex~=md\:items-start]{align-items:flex-start}.md\:items-center,[flex~=md\:items-center]{align-items:center}.md\:justify-between,[flex~=md\:justify-between]{justify-content:space-between}[gap~="md:2.75"]{gap:.6875rem}[p~=md\:6]{padding:1.5rem}[p~=md\:x-8]{padding-left:2rem;padding-right:2rem}[p~=md\:y-14]{padding-top:3.5rem;padding-bottom:3.5rem}[p~=md\:r-0]{padding-right:0}[text~=md\:left]{text-align:left}[text~=md\:3xl]{font-size:1.875rem;line-height:2.25rem}[text~=md\:4xl]{font-size:2.25rem;line-height:2.5rem}}@media (width>=1024px){[p~=lg\:x-12]{padding-left:3rem;padding-right:3rem}}:root{color:#2f3a3d;--background:39 21% 87%;--foreground:193 13% 21%;--card:36 35% 92%;--card-foreground:193 13% 21%;--popover:36 35% 92%;--popover-foreground:193 13% 21%;--primary:193 13% 21%;--primary-foreground:39 21% 87%;--secondary:39 18% 80%;--secondary-foreground:193 13% 21%;--muted:39 18% 80%;--muted-foreground:193 8% 38%;--accent:34 34% 46%;--accent-foreground:39 21% 87%;--destructive:0 84% 60%;--destructive-foreground:39 21% 87%;--border:193 13% 21% / .16;--input:193 13% 21% / .2;--ring:34 34% 46%;--brand-background:#e5e0d7;--brand-accent:#9c7a4d;--brand-ink:#2f3a3d;--brand-card:#f2ede5;--radius:.5rem;background:#e5e0d7;font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}body{min-width:320px;min-height:100vh;margin:0}button,input,textarea,select{font:inherit}.wordmark.svelte-w6obn8{letter-spacing:0;font-family:Khmer MN,Times New Roman,serif}.footer-logo.svelte-w6obn8{filter:brightness(0)saturate()invert(93%)sepia(8%)saturate(333%)hue-rotate(354deg)brightness(97%)contrast(88%)}.footer-link.svelte-w6obn8{color:#e5e0d7c7;width:fit-content;text-decoration:none;transition:color .16s,transform .16s}.footer-link.svelte-w6obn8:hover{color:var(--brand-background);transform:translate(.18rem)}div.svelte-k1kxfq{display:inline-block}.shopping-cart-icon.svelte-k1kxfq{transform-origin:50%;transition:transform .2s ease-in-out}.shopping-cart-icon.animate.svelte-k1kxfq{animation:.8s ease-in-out svelte-k1kxfq-cartBounce}@keyframes svelte-k1kxfq-cartBounce{0%,to{transform:scale(1)translateY(0)}25%{transform:scale(1.1)translateY(-5px)}50%{transform:scale(1)translateY(0)}75%{transform:scale(1.1)translateY(-5px)}}.wordmark.svelte-118byhy{letter-spacing:0;font-family:Khmer MN,Times New Roman,serif}.menu-trigger.svelte-118byhy{z-index:70;touch-action:manipulation;-webkit-tap-highlight-color:transparent;width:3rem;height:3rem;position:fixed;top:1.25rem;right:1rem}.menu-trigger.svelte-118byhy span:where(.svelte-118byhy){transform-origin:50%;background:currentColor;border-radius:999px;width:18px;height:2px;margin-inline:auto;transition:transform .18s,opacity .14s,background .18s;display:block}.menu-trigger.is-open.svelte-118byhy span:where(.svelte-118byhy):first-child{transform:translateY(7px)rotate(45deg)}.menu-trigger.is-open.svelte-118byhy span:where(.svelte-118byhy):nth-child(2){opacity:0}.menu-trigger.is-open.svelte-118byhy span:where(.svelte-118byhy):nth-child(3){transform:translateY(-7px)rotate(-45deg)}
